Helium Music Manager

Helium Music Manager is a powerful music library management application designed for cataloging, tagging, playing, and organizing your digital music collection. It offers comprehensive tools for editing metadata, renaming files, ripping CDs, and synchronizing with various devices. by Intermedia Software

Zune Software

Zune Software served as Microsoft's comprehensive media management platform for Windows. It allowed users to organize, play, and synchronize music, videos, and podcasts, primarily designed to work seamlessly with the Zune portable media player. by Microsoft

Zune Software

Zune Software

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Visually appealing and user-friendly interface.
Seamless synchronization with Zune devices.
Robust media library management features.
Integrated Zune Marketplace for content acquisition.
Effective Smart Playlists feature.

Limitations

Primarily tied to Zune hardware, limiting broader compatibility.
Can be resource-intensive, especially with large libraries.
Software is discontinued, meaning no future updates or support.
Dependence on a now-defunct online marketplace.
